Indonesian UN Peacekeeper Becomes Sixth Killed in Lebanon Conflict

In a tragic escalation of violence in southern Lebanon, an Indonesian United Nations peacekeeper has been killed, marking the sixth UN peacekeeper to lose their life in the recent hostilities in the region. This incident underscores the increasing risks faced by international personnel deployed to maintain peace and stability in conflict-prone areas.

The peacekeeper, a soldier from Indonesia, was serving under the United Nations Interim Force in Lebanon (UNIFIL), which has been tasked with monitoring ceasefire lines and supporting the Lebanese government in maintaining security along the southern border. The death of this soldier highlights the volatile and dangerous conditions under which UN peacekeepers operate.

Southern Lebanon has been a hotspot for clashes and armed confrontations, often involving various factions and groups. The presence of UNIFIL aims to prevent escalation and ensure a buffer zone to protect civilians and reduce the likelihood of broader conflict.

This latest casualty comes amid rising tensions and ongoing confrontations that have resulted in damage to infrastructure and displacement of residents. The Indonesian soldier’s death is a somber reminder of the high stakes and human costs involved in peacekeeping missions.

The United Nations and international community have expressed deep condolences to the family, fellow peacekeepers, and Indonesia. They have reiterated their commitment to the mission in Lebanon and the importance of safeguarding those who serve in such challenging circumstances.

Efforts are underway to investigate the circumstances surrounding the death and to evaluate how peacekeeping operations can be enhanced to prevent further loss of life. The loss of six peacekeepers so far in this conflict zone highlights the urgent need for dialogue, de-escalation of violence, and stronger protective measures on the ground.

Indonesia has historically been an active contributor to UN peacekeeping forces worldwide, reflecting its dedication to international peace and security. The sacrifice of its soldier in Lebanon further galvanizes calls for renewed diplomacy and concerted international action to resolve the underlying conflicts.

As the situation in southern Lebanon remains precarious, the global community watches closely, hoping for a cessation of hostilities and a safer environment for both civilians and peacekeepers alike. The memory of those who have fallen in service remains a potent motivation for continued efforts towards lasting peace in the region.
